Manchester To Birmingham: Frequently asked questions

Travel Planning

By Bus

Is there a direct bus from Manchester to Birmingham? Yes, there are direct bus options available ensuring a convenient journey.

How often do buses run between Manchester and Birmingham? Buses for this route run regularly throughout the day for added flexibility.

How long does the bus journey take from Manchester to Birmingham? The bus journey can take approximately 2-3 hours, though this may vary.

What amenities can I expect on buses from Manchester to Birmingham? Standard amenities include Wi-Fi, power sockets, and comfortable seating.

Are there night bus services from Manchester to Birmingham? Late-night bus services are available for travellers preferring overnight travel.

Where do I board my bus in Manchester for Birmingham? Main departure points include Manchester Coach Station among other pick-up spots.

Can I travel with luggage on the bus? Yes, luggage compartments are available, but be aware of your carrier’s policies.

Do Manchester to Birmingham buses offer disabled access? Most buses have facilities to accommodate passengers with disabilities.

Can I buy a bus ticket on the day of travel? While possible, booking in advance online might offer better rates and secure your seat.

Are there discounts for group travel by bus? Group travel often comes with discounts, but check with the bus company for specifics.

By Train

Are there any direct train services from Manchester to Birmingham? Direct train services are available, facilitating a straight route to your destination.

What is the travel duration on the train from Manchester to Birmingham? Train travel times vary, ranging from 1.5 to 2 hours typically.

What facilities are available on the Manchester to Birmingham trains? Trains generally provide catering services, restrooms, and sometimes free Wi-Fi.

Are there any concession fares for train travel? Certain categories of passengers, including children and seniors, may receive discounts.

Can I use my railcard for the Manchester to Birmingham train? Yes, railcards are accepted and can offer significant savings on your journey.

What are the peak travel times for trains on the Manchester to Birmingham route? Peak times usually occur during early mornings and late afternoons on weekdays.

Is seat reservation possible on the Manchester to Birmingham train? Seat reservations are possible and recommended during busy periods for convenience.

Are trains from Manchester to Birmingham accessible for wheelchair users? Yes, trains are equipped with features to assist travellers with reduced mobility.

Can I purchase train tickets at the station? Yes, tickets can be bought at the station although pre-booking might be cheaper.

How frequently do trains from Manchester to Birmingham run? The frequency of services is high, with multiple trains available hourly.
